Simple Synthesis of 1,3‐Dialkylimidazole‐2‐chalcogenones (E=S, Se, Te) from NHC−CO <sub>2</sub> Adducts

We present a high yield synthesis of 1-ethyl-3-methyl-imidazole-2-chalcogenones from readily available imidazolium-2-carboxylate zwitterions NHC−CO2 and elemental chalcogens. In sharp contrast to previous syntheses for corresponding thiones selones imidazolium salts bases our reactions proceed fast with full instead low conversion selectivity, decarboxylation is the driving force. Furthermore, this strategy applicable all heavier chalcogens including tellurium. Vacuum sublimation imidazole-2-chalcogenones implemented as convenient method purification leading solid liquid products reported in literature. Newly prepared 1-ethyl-3-methyl-imidazole-2-tellone was characterized by XRD analysis correlation study 125Te NMR 13C shifts respect known representatives. The reaction TMS2S leads NHC−COS, analysis, whereas chalcogen derivatives TMS2E (E=Se, Te) did not react NHC activated CO2.

Solid state polyselenides and polytellurides: a large variety of Se-Se and Te-Te interactions.

A large variety of different interactions between the chalcogen atoms, Q, occur in the solid state structures of polyselenides and polytellurides, including both molecular and infinite units. The simplest motifs are classical Q(2)(2-) dumbbells and nonlinear Q(n)(2-) chains (n = 3, 4, 5, ..), e.g. found in alkali metal polychalcogenides.
